Fl500 Laser Diode Driver . The fl500 is ideal for driving low power laser diodes where low noise is critical. The fl591fl evaluation board allows you to quickly and efficiently evaluate the fl500 laser diode driver and prototype your laser electronics system. The fl500 is ideal for driving low power laser diodes where low noise is critical. Fl500 500 ma laser diode driver. It operates from 3 to 12 v, so is compatible with li+ battery operation.
